DIY Faraday Box for Key Fob: Exploring Tin Foil as a Signal Blocker

Keyless entry systems in modern vehicles offer convenience, but they also introduce security vulnerabilities. One concern is relay attacks, where thieves can amplify and relay your key fob’s signal to unlock and start your car. A Faraday box for your key fob is a protective enclosure designed to block these signals, adding a layer of security against such attacks. Many commercially available Faraday pouches and boxes utilize specialized RFID-blocking fabric, often boasting multiple layers for enhanced protection. But what about a DIY approach using readily available materials?

Intrigued by the concept of a DIY solution, I decided to test a method I encountered: constructing a Faraday box using simple tin foil. Skepticism lingered, particularly regarding the effectiveness of such a common household item. To put it to the test, I fashioned a small cardboard box and lined it with two layers of standard tin foil, ensuring complete coverage as best as I could. For a practical experiment, I placed my smartphone inside this makeshift box.

The moment of truth arrived with a phone call. If the phone rang while enclosed in the foil-lined box, it would indicate signal penetration, and thus, failure. If it remained silent, it would suggest the tin foil was indeed blocking the signal, acting as a rudimentary Faraday cage. My wife, witnessing my somewhat unconventional experiment, dialed my number. The phone rang. Initial disappointment led to closer inspection of my tin foil construction. It was then I noticed a tiny gap, approximately 2 centimeters long and barely a few millimeters wide, in one of the foil seams. Sealing this minute opening, we tried again.

This time, silence. The phone remained stubbornly unresponsive to incoming calls, confirming that even a small imperfection in the shielding could compromise its effectiveness. My wife, initially doubtful, was genuinely surprised by the result. This simple experiment highlighted a crucial aspect of Faraday cages: complete and uninterrupted enclosure is paramount for effective signal blocking.
